Background

Drop-in daycare facilities very first started initially to gain popularity during the early 2000s as a response to the altering needs of modern people. With an increase of parents working non-traditional hours or freelance tasks, the standard 9-5 daycare design no more fit their particular schedules. Also, many people found it challenging to secure affordable and dependable childcare on quick notice, particularly in problems or unexpected situations.

Drop-in daycare facilities filled this space by offering flexible hours, no reservation demands, and inexpensive rates. They supplied a safe and nurturing environment for kids while enabling moms and dads to attend conferences, run errands, or just take a much-needed break. Thus, drop-in daycare quickly became a well known selection for busy households selecting convenient and dependable childcare solutions.

Difficulties and possibilities

While drop-in daycare centers like ABC Drop-In Daycare have proven to be effective, they also face a number of difficulties in satisfying the needs of families and remaining competitive shopping. One of the most significant difficulties is making sure an adequate staff-to-child proportion to steadfastly keep up a safe and supporting environment for several kids. This is hard during maximum hours or whenever unforeseen demand occurs, calling for facilities to-be versatile and innovative inside their staffing strategies.

Another challenge for drop-in daycare centers is managing the fluctuating need for services through the day and week. Though some times may be busier than others, facilities needs to be willing to accommodate all children inside their treatment and offer quality solutions constantly. This calls for careful scheduling and coordination to ensure staff and resources tend to be allocated efficiently.
